About Gastric Ballooning

Gastric ballooning is a technique which is used for avoiding bariatric surgery under conditions where patient is extremely overweight etc. In the procedure an inflatable balloon is delivered inside the stomach of the person ususally with the help of an endoscope. The balloon is inflated and is left inside the stomach of the person. The presence of balloon limits the eating capacity of the person and generates a sensation of full stomach after eating a little.
